Which MBTI types hate small talk?

MBTI types that often dislike small talk are primarily Introverted Intuitive (IN) types like INTJ, INTP, INFJ, and INFP, who find it superficial and draining, preferring deep, meaningful conversations, along with Introverted Thinkers (T-types) like ISTP who prefer action or substance over idle chat. These types often view small talk as a waste of time, seeking intellectual connection or purposeful interaction instead of light, superficial exchanges, though some Sensing types (like ISTP/ESTP) dislike it if it lacks stimulation or action.

What does it mean if you hate small talk?

Many people dislike small talk due to it feeling tedious and unnecessary to them. For others, engaging in small talk is a vital part of social interaction and relationship-building. Neurodivergence, gender, and culture all play a part in expectations of social interactions.

Do all introverts hate small talk?

Laurie Helgoe points out in her fascinating book, Introvert Power, “Introverts do not hate small talk because we dislike people. We hate small talk because we hate the barrier it creates between people.” Small talk doesn't bring people closer.

Which MBTI hate conflict?

Introverts Are Nearly Three Times More Likely to Avoid Conflict Than Extraverts. Sunnyvale, Calif. Dec 29, 2022 – In honor of World Introvert Day (Jan. 2, 2023), The Myers-Briggs Company has shared new data from over 50,000 respondents about how Introverts manage conflict.

Which MBTI is prone to addiction?

ISFP. Easygoing, creative, spontaneous, and modest, ISFPs may be more likely than others to self-medicate with substances. One study compared personality traits among people struggling with addiction. The researchers found ISFP to be one of the most common MBTI types among those who also struggled with a mood disorder.
